But … Web7 okt. 2024 · To become a doctor in the United States, it will take 11 to 14 years. Aspiring doctors need to earn a four-year bachelor’s degree, attend four years of medical school, and complete a three- to seven-year residency program. Only after completing these stages can a doctor apply for a state license to practice medicine.

Web1 jul. 2024 · Doctors in the United States spend many years acquiring the necessary education and skills to practice medicine. The preparation for medical school usually begins in high school with an emphasis on math and science.
